How do I stop telemarketers from calling me?
                     
 




Arkansas_boy
Rating
Add your number to the "Do Not Call" List.

Here's the link to add your number: https://www.donotcall.gov/

FAQ's are answered on this link: http://www.ftc.gov/bcp/edu/pubs/consumer/alerts/alt107.shtm


Kortney
You can go to the National Do Not Call Registry website to register your number on a government list that makes it against the law for those companies to call you. If they do, you can contact them or the FCC and complain, as long as you have some sort of information or proof of their call. Here is the link to register online: https://www.donotcall.gov/register/reg.aspx

Or you can register by calling from the phone of which number you wish to restrict by calling 1-888-382-1222.
